Intern Electronic Engineer
Mar 2014 - Sept 2014
I worked as part of a multidisciplinary team that was responsible or designing and building a smart metrology fixture capable of automatically acquiring multiple measurements of a component at the push of a button. I had to design and build electronic circuits which created a link between a programmable embedded system and pneumatics to control the automation sequences. I developed the C program for the embedded system from the ground up which is capable of measuring temperature, controlling pneumatics, controlling a CCD Micrometer, controller RS232 communications to a PC much more. The smart metrology fixture is interfaced with a data-collection software package on a PC which displays and stores the measurements taken by the automated smart fixture.
Intern Technician
Jun 2013 - Sept 2013
I worked as part of team with mechanical designers and tool makers to build multiple smart metrology fixtures to be used in the medical device industry. Each smart fixture used either pneumatically controlled touch probes or a CCD Micrometer to take multiple measurements of a component. I was responsible for building the electronic circuits which controlled the measurement instruments and the data collection along with designing and implementing suitable pneumatic circuits for controlling the touch probes. I was section lead for an external CE audit assessment where all smart metrology fixtures and stations needed to appropriately approved for their intended use. This is involved completing the majority of the documents in order to achieve the CE approval and making necessary adjustments to the fixtures and stations to ensure it complied. I also went on site to multiple medical device companies in order to test and install the smart metrology fixtures.
